Come build the future of money with us!\nThe Role\nWe are looking for an ASIC Validation Engineer to help bridge the gap between custom mining silicon design and real-world operation. In this highly hands-on, lab-focused role, you'll work closely with ASIC designers and system engineers to debug issues, build test infrastructure, and generate the data needed to enable rapid design iteration and system-level development.\n\nYou Will:\nBring up new silicon on bench platforms, evaluation boards, and system hardware\nDebug issues across ASIC, board, firmware, and system interactions\nDevelop bench tests, scripts, and tools to exercise silicon features and collect data\nBuild and maintain test setups (lab automation, instrumentation, fixtures, scripts)\nPartner with ASIC designers to validate functionality and root-cause failures\nWork with system engineers to ensure silicon performs correctly in target system environments, including mining systems\nGenerate and analyze data to support design decisions, characterization, and bring-up\nCreate lightweight, reusable test workflows and documentation for the broader team\nSupport early manufacturing efforts with practical validation and debug, as needed\nTravel up to 20% to the labs in Oakland, CA or Toronto, Canada\nYou Have:\nBach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ering or related field\n4+ years of experience in silicon validation, hardware test, or related roles\nStrong hands-on experience in a lab environment (bench bring-up, debugging, instrumentation)\nSolid understanding of digital systems and basic analog concepts\nExperience writing scripts or tools (Python preferred) for test and data analysis\nComfortable debugging issues that span multiple layers (ASIC board system)\nClear communication skills and ability to work closely with cross-functional teams\n\nPreferred:\nExperience with ASIC or FPGA bring-up and validation\nFamiliarity with common interfaces (SPI, I2C, JTAG, UART, etc.)\nExperience using lab equipment (o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, power supplies, etc.)\nExposure to high-performance, power-dense systems (e.g., mining ASICs, accelerators, or similar)\nExperience building test automation or internal tooling\nFamiliarity with data analysis and visualization\n\nNice to Have\nExperience working with early silicon / first bring-up environments\nExposure to manufacturing test or ATE\nExperience working on systems with tight power, thermal, and performance constraints\n\nWhy This Role Matters\nThis role enables the team to move fast. By building the right test infrastructure and quickly turning hardware behavior into actionable data, you'll help both ASIC and system teams iterate faster and make better decisions across silicon and mining system development.\nWe're working to build a more inclusive economy where our customers have equal access to opportunity, and we strive to live by these same values in building our workplace.
